Metric Mania

Weird, right? We sell all sorts of random crap, but who would buy a blood pressure monitor on a whim? A lot of people, as it turns out. Some have specific health reasons, others have doctors orders, but a large number of purchasers are just geeks who track every bodily datum.Our own @dave is one of these health metric obsessors. Hes got a Wi-Fi scale, a fitness tracking watch, and, yes, a blood pressure monitor. Why does @dave do it? > "You might assume I’m sickly, or at least a hypochondriac, but it’s more just love of stats."Yes, tracking these stats lets you follow trends and identify causes in your own health, such as the general bodily deterioration that follows the release of a new Civilization game. But mostly, its satisfying. Theres something dopamine-releasing about seeing your own life neatly arranged in a spreadsheet. Theres a reason its so (relatively) popular.No trend would be complete without bandwagoning, of course.
